Product Insights & Style Tips

Marc Jacobs Women's Faux Fur Cropped Jeans fuse luxe texture with streetwise swagger. The cotton denim feels sturdy and breathable, finished in a dark slub indigo that looks lived-in but refined. Faux fur trims the hems for a playful, tactile edge, while silvertone J hardware punctuates the five-pocket silhouette and the button fly with signature Marc Jacobs shine.

Ankle cropped with an inseam of about 27.2 inches, they skim the ankle without clinging, letting footwear take center stage. The five-pocket layout keeps everyday items neatly stashed, and the button fly keeps the front clean and streamlined. Because the denim is 100 percent cotton, the fit tends to relax with wear, making them easy to layer over a chunky knit, under a leather jacket, or with a sleek blazer for a night-out transition.

These jeans sit squarely in Contemporary Sportswear energy, a Marc Jacobs move that blends luxury detail with off-duty ease. The faux fur trim and J hardware read as quiet but unmistakable brand cues, while the cropped length and shade of dark indigo keep them versatile enough to pair with everything from chunky sneakers to ankle boots.

Materials / Fabrication

  • Cotton denim
  • Ankle-cropped silhouette
  • Faux fur-trimmed hems
  • Silvertone J hardware
  • Five-pocket styling
  • Button fly closure
  • Shell: 100 percent cotton
  • Imported
  • Color: Dark Slub Indigo
  • Inseam: about 27.2 in

Recommended Care

  • Dry clean only to preserve denim, fur trim, and hardware

About Marc Jacobs

Established by the eponymous designer in 1984, the Marc Jacobs brand has become synonymous with pushing boundaries and redefining the very essence of modern womenswear. At the core of Marc Jacobs' success lies a relentless pursuit of originality, seamlessly blending avant-garde aesthetics with a deep appreciation for classic elegance. From the iconic grunge-inspired Perry Ellis collection in 1992 to the sophisticated glamour of his eponymous line, Jacobs has consistently demonstrated an unparalleled ability to adapt to the evolving fashion landscape while maintaining his distinct voice.
